Hobby Boss 1:48 Messerschmitt Me-262 A-1b
Plastic Model Kit
This is a Hobby Boss Messerschmitt Me-262 A-1b Plastic Model Kit. The Me-262 "Storm Bird" was a German fighter aircraft flown during late World War II. It was the first jet to be used in war. First flown July 18, 1942, the Me-262 first appeared in the skies over Europe in 1944 and claimed a total of 509 Allied kills. The Me-262 family filled a variety of roles, including light bomber, reconnaissance, heavy weapon and even experimental night fighter versions. Me-262 A-1b as same as A-1a but powered with BMW 003 engines.
